Output d83f4a8aea49ac3ea8054179f3a5377edb4445f198d76caa2e080ee3f5194636:85

value
12286137
script pubkey
OP_0 OP_PUSHBYTES_20 07d1848b50d03c42728f86a1b65b0578df9dd476
address
bc1qqlgcfz6s6q7yyu50s6smvkc90r0em4rkreut6c
transaction
d83f4a8aea49ac3ea8054179f3a5377edb4445f198d76caa2e080ee3f5194636
confirmations
51519
spent
true